Before the incident
Employee was stepping off of a ladder and onto an aircraft wing that was covered in water when he slipped and fell to the hangar floor. Employee was not using mandatory fall protection equipment he was trained on and provided by the employer.
What happened
Slipped off the wing.
Injury or illness
Contusion to the right side of his head and his right elbow was fractured.
Object or substance involved
Hangar floor
Summary line
Transferring from a ladder to a aircraft and fell
